Siri Settlement Approved: Apple to Pay Owners of Some iPhone Models
Summary
Apple settled a U.S. class action lawsuit over delayed Siri AI features by agreeing to pay $250 million. Eligible iPhone 15 Pro and 16 series owners may receive $25 to $95 per device, depending on claim volume. The settlement was preliminarily approved in July 2025, but a claims website is not yet live. Eligible users will be notified via email within 45 days after the site launches, though physical device possession may not be required. Apple emphasized focusing on innovation post-settlement, with a revamped 'Siri AI' launching in iOS 27 later this year.
